I get vested in my guys. I want to know who their family members are, I want to know their interests, I want to know what makes them tick. I want them to also know I care about the other side of them, their personal character and growth as men, because I think we all sharpen each other that way.
Monty Williams
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Investing in personal relationships fosters growth and teamwork.

In this quote, Monty Williams emphasizes the importance of knowing and understanding the individuals on your team beyond their professional roles. By caring about their personal lives and character development, a leader can create a supportive environment that enhances collaboration and personal growth, ultimately benefiting the entire team.
